Abstract :
Exact analytic expressions for magnetostatic energy calculations in arrays of ferromagnetic prisms are presented. They apply to two-dimensional (2-D) and three-dimensional (3-D) arrays of variable length prisms with uniform magnetization inside each prism. This permits the study of irregular magnetic structures allowing also a variable grid where the size of the cells depends on the structure itself. These expressions cover all possible cases for 2-D and 3-D problems
